What companies run services between Braşov, Romania and Bucharest, Romania?

Transferoviar Călători (TFC) operates a train from Brașov to Bucharest hourly. Tickets cost $7–22 and the journey takes 2h 35m. Four other operators also service this route.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Brașov to Piata 21 Decembrie 1989 via Aeroport Henri Coanda Sosiri in around 3h 3m.
